Output e5401f177165117962321bfaa5c92b616616750a115dc7c21c7a82510f77ebb6:27

value
1444191
script pubkey
OP_0 OP_PUSHBYTES_20 56bf20af357c34df50fc15b6e29a34b089305cbd
address
bc1q26ljpte40s6d758uzkmw9x35kzynqh9a7ldzpu
transaction
e5401f177165117962321bfaa5c92b616616750a115dc7c21c7a82510f77ebb6